First off, let's quickly understand what WPC wall panels are. WPC stands for Wood Plastic Composite. These panels are a blend of wood fibers and thermoplastics, which gives them a unique combination of the natural look of wood and the durability of plastic. They're super popular for outdoor use because they're resistant to moisture, rot, and insects. Now, onto the main question: what's the load - bearing capacity of outdoor WPC wall panels? Well, it's not a one - size - fits - all answer. There are several factors that can influence the load - bearing capacity of these panels.

1. Material Composition

The ratio of wood fibers to plastic in the WPC mix plays a big role. Panels with a higher proportion of plastic tend to be more rigid and can generally handle more weight. Plastic provides better structural integrity and can distribute the load more evenly. On the other hand, if there's too much wood fiber, the panel might be more prone to bending or breaking under heavy loads. 2. Panel Thickness

Thicker panels are usually stronger and can bear more weight. A thin WPC wall panel might be fine for a simple decorative wall where there's not much stress, but if you're planning to use it in a situation where it needs to support some weight, like a partition wall with some equipment hanging on it, a thicker panel is the way to go. For example, a 10 - millimeter thick panel will have a lower load - bearing capacity compared to a 20 - millimeter thick one.

3. Installation Method

How the panels are installed is crucial. If they're properly secured to a sturdy frame or structure, they can handle more weight. We always recommend using the right fasteners and following the installation guidelines carefully. For instance, if the panels are just loosely attached, they won't be able to transfer the load effectively to the supporting structure, and this can lead to premature failure.

4. Environmental Conditions

Outdoor conditions can have an impact on the load - bearing capacity of WPC wall panels. Extreme temperatures, high humidity, and exposure to sunlight can all affect the material over time. In hot weather, the plastic in the WPC can expand, which might change the panel's dimensions slightly. On the other hand, cold temperatures can make the material more brittle. Also, if the panels are constantly exposed to moisture, it can cause the wood fibers to swell, potentially weakening the panel.

To give you a rough idea of the load - bearing capacity, in normal outdoor conditions and with proper installation, a standard 15 - millimeter thick WPC wall panel can typically support a static load of around 20 - 30 kilograms per square meter. But this is just a ballpark figure, and it can vary depending on the factors we've discussed above.

Let's talk about some real - world applications. If you're using our WPC wall panels for a small garden shed, the load - bearing requirements are relatively low. The panels mainly need to withstand their own weight and maybe a little bit of wind pressure. In this case, a thinner panel might be sufficient.

However, if you're building a large outdoor pavilion or a commercial outdoor structure, you'll need to consider the load - bearing capacity more carefully. You might need to use thicker panels and ensure a more robust installation. For example, if you plan to hang some heavy lighting fixtures or signage on the wall, you need to make sure the panels can handle the additional weight.

Another important thing to note is that the load - bearing capacity is not just about static loads. Dynamic loads, like the force from strong winds or people bumping into the wall, also need to be considered. Our panels are designed to have some flexibility to absorb these dynamic forces without breaking.
